Haikyu!! is a popular anime series that has gained a huge following all over the world. The show revolves around a high school volleyball team called Karasuno High and their journey to become one of the best in Japan. The characters in the show are diverse and unique, each with their own personality and backstory. In this article, we will go through a list of Haikyu!! characters.

1. Hinata Shoyo

Hinata is the protagonist of the series and a first-year student at Karasuno High. He is short in stature but has a knack for volleyball. He is determined to become a great volleyball player and idolizes one of the best players in Japan, the “Little Giant.”

2. Kageyama Tobio

Kageyama is a talented volleyball player who is often called “the king of the court.” He is very demanding and can be harsh towards his teammates. However, he is also very driven and wants to become the best player in Japan. As the setter for Karasuno, he forms a powerful duo with Hinata.

3. Tsukishima Kei

Tsukishima is a tall first-year student who initially doesn’t take volleyball seriously. He is quite stoic and indifferent towards the sport, but gradually becomes more passionate about it as he sees the other players’ dedication. He is known for his sharp wit and can be quite sarcastic at times.

4. Nishinoya Yuu

Nishinoya is Karasuno’s libero, which means he is responsible for defending the back row. He is a highly skilled player who is known for his acrobatic moves and ability to read the opposing team’s attacks. He is extroverted and outgoing, and is often seen teasing and joking around with his teammates.

5. Sawamura Daichi

Daichi is the captain of Karasuno and a reliable player on the court. He’s a third-year student who takes his responsibilities very seriously. He’s focused and level-headed, which makes him a great leader for the team. He also has a soft spot for his younger teammates, especially Hinata and Kageyama.

6. Sugawara Koushi

Sugawara is Karasuno’s backup setter and a third-year student. He’s a friendly and cheerful person who is always ready to offer encouragement to his teammates. He’s also very perceptive and often provides advice to Hinata and Kageyama when they’re struggling.

7. Yamaguchi Tadashi

Yamaguchi is a first-year student who is often underestimated due to his lack of athleticism. However, he’s determined to become a better player and often stays late to practice serves. Yamaguchi is also quite shy and reserved, but he becomes more confident as the series progresses.

8. Tanaka Ryuunosuke

Tanaka is a second-year student and one of Karasuno’s outside hitters. He’s known for his fiery personality and can be quite hot-headed at times. However, he’s also fiercely loyal to his teammates and always tries to lift their spirits when they’re feeling down.

9. Asahi Azumane

Asahi is Karasuno’s ace, which means he’s the team’s main hitter. He’s a third-year student who initially quit the volleyball team due to a loss of confidence. However, he eventually returns and becomes a vital member of the team. Asahi is quite gentle and caring, which makes him a good role model for the younger players.

10. Oikawa Tooru

Oikawa is the setter for Aoba Johsai, which is one of Karasuno’s rival teams. He’s known for his charismatic personality and his ability to read his opponents’ movements. Oikawa and Kageyama have a contentious relationship, as both are highly competitive and want to be the best setter in Japan.
